Design and make individual professionally finished jewellery in this one day course. Beginners will follow a suitable project to cover the basic skills, a simple cut pair of earrings or pendant designed by you. Group and individual tuition will be given given during the day where appropriate and those with a little more experience can work on individual projects or complete ones started on other courses with Kent Adult Education.

How will I be taught?
Tutors will use a variety of teaching methods including demonstration, instructions, one-to-one tutorial guidance, group discussions and critiques. Students will be encouraged to look at the work of other craftspeople and artists, both contemporary and historical and keep a sketchbook/ notebook to record goals/ ideas, processes and progress. It is important to note that craft courses are practical, requiring a degree of manual dexterity. Our courses are taught by qualified and experienced tutors most of whom are practising craftspeople.
Your tutor will give you individual feedback throughout the course.
What do I need to bring with me?
You will need to meet the cost of their materials and these will be costed by weight depending on the prices at the time of the course. You can bring along beads and other objects that you may want to include in your jewellery. You will need an A4 sketchbook, pencil and pen for ideas and notes and a protective apron or overall. Tools are available at the centre although you might like to buy your own after consulting with the tutor. You will be required to wear protective goggles for some techniques. Basic goggles are available at the centre but for clarity students are advised to purchase their own.
